Regulatory Framework and Compliance
Navigating the regulatory landscape is essential. The Interactive Gambling Act 2001 (IGA) forms the cornerstone of online gambling regulation in Australia. However, the interpretation and enforcement of the IGA, along with state-based regulations, are constantly evolving. Stay informed about legislative changes, court rulings, and regulatory updates. Understand the licensing requirements for online casino operators, and the compliance obligations they must meet. Analyze the impact of responsible gambling initiatives and the measures operators are taking to protect vulnerable players. This includes understanding age verification processes, self-exclusion programs, and the promotion of responsible gambling messages. Consider the role of independent regulatory bodies and their impact on market integrity and consumer protection.
